Title request allowed on available item -- despite Z305_HOLD_ON_SHELF = N

Description:
In ABC50 we have tab15.eng, col. 8, set to "Y" (allow holds; but allow them on available items only if the Local Patron "Allow hold on available item" privilege is set to Y).
The system allowed patron ABC500010 to place a hold on item 007556519-20 despite the fact that patron ABC500010 has "Allow hold on available item" (Z305_HOLD_ON_SHELF) set to N.
Resolution:
I note (in the z37h) that the hold placed by patron ABC500010 on item 007556519-20 was a title hold:
z37h_request_type ..............T
Looking at the sys50 tab_hold_request, I find that there are no TITLE-REQ (or HL-GRP) lines. It seems to me that there *should* be.
Please create TITLE-REQ entries with the check_hold_request checks that you want to be in effect.
From the tab_hold_request header:
! g : z305 hold-on-shelf (item availability)
Please be sure that this line is included:
TITLE-REQ check_hold_request_g
Then restart the pc_server and test.
If you find that the problem still exists, then please add the same check_hold_request checks under the HL-GRP label. (It's unclear to me just when HL-GRP is referenced vs. TITLE-REQ; please start with the checks under just TITLE-REQ.)
[From site:]
Adding this line:
TITLE-REQ check_hold_request_g
corrected the problem.
